Support agents should never advise customers to swap font files manually; licensing restrictions vary per family, and an unreviewed replacement can void our redistribution terms. If a customer reports rendering issues or asks about adding a new typeface, gather the product version and font family name, then route the request to the Glyphworks licensing desk at the address below.

alerts address for tafog-tagef: casath@qorvellabs.corp

Welcome to the Lanternbrook consent-banner rollout. The banner is being deployed region by region, with configuration controlled by the Clearform flag service; never edit flags directly in production. Each region has its own legal copy, so translations must be pulled from the approved strings table rather than hardcoded. Contractors should start by shadowing a rollout in the staging tenant, then pick up tickets tagged for the next wave. The rollout schedule, flag names, and review checklist are maintained on the internal page here.

operations page: https://jenkins.zemvarcloud.local/job/merge_requests/repo/build/73930b4b30f0a8ed

**TICKET-2087: Spoolhawk creds expired**

Hey — welcome aboard! First task: the Spoolhawk printer-spooler microservice stopped accepting jobs this morning because its credential for the internal Inkrelay queue expired. Print jobs are piling up in three offices.

Fix is easy: drop the new credential into Spoolhawk's config map and restart the pod. Don't touch the queue side — that's already been re-issued.

Here's the new key for the Inkrelay service.

API key for yahig-tadup: kto7_ubizbYm

## Graphsmith Environments

Quick orientation for the new contractor: Graphsmith, our dependency graph visualizer, runs in three environments—dev, staging, and prod. Dev rebuilds the graph on every push, staging refreshes nightly, and prod only updates after a tagged release. Don't worry if staging looks a bit behind; that's normal. Each environment picks up its settings from the values listed below.

settings of fafog-haduf:
ZORIX_PIN=4648
ZORIX_METRICS_HOST=metrics.zorix.paliqsys.corp
ZORIX_LOG_LEVEL=info
ZORIX_TENANT=druix